A fine pair of George I walnut dining chairs Early 18th century The moulded top rail with scrolled beading above a solid vase shaped splat, with drop in seats with 18th century needlepoint upholstery supplied by Peta Smythe Antique Textiles on front cabriole legs and pad feet united by double concave stretchers, 58cm wide x 58cm deep x 105cm high, (22 1/2in wide x 22 1/2in deep x 41in high) (2) Footnotes: Provenance Christie's, London, Important English Furniture, 10 July 2003, lot 48, where bought by the previous owner.
